Luís Correia

Development Lead at Miniclip

Luís Correia has a diverse work experience in the tech industry spanning over several companies. Luís started their career at Hiperbit in 1995, where they worked as a Senior Programmer and Project Manager. Luís was involved in developing a client-server application for managing students at Universidade Lusófona. Afterward, they joined Innovagency in 2003 as a Senior Programmer and Solution Architect, working on projects such as creating a website for the ESAF using C# and MSCMS. In 2006, Luís joined CPIfo as a Senior Software Developer before moving to Gameinvest in 2008, where they worked as a Senior Programmer and Coordinator in game development. Luís was responsible for research on development tools for Sony PS3 and PSP consoles and also worked on a 2D game framework for the Windows platform. Lastly, Luís joined Miniclip in 2011 and held various positions such as Senior Developer and Development Lead.

Luís Correia attended the Instituto Superior Técnico from 1989 to 2006. During this time, they studied Engenharia Electrotecnica e Computadores with a focus on Robótica. The information does not specify if they obtained a degree.
